Vault Labels
You will learn how to print and use Vault Labels in Bravo to organize and identify items stored securely, especially for firearms and high-value inventory.
Vault labels are 3"x2.25" labels for loan and buy ticket items that display information in a more expanded, visible format than regular labels, large ticket labels, and master jewelry labels. When configured, these labels print from the Special Label printer.
System Configuration
Under System Configuration > Configuration tab > POP CONFIG, a Vault Labels configuration can be set to one of three options:
- No Vault Label - No vault labels will be printed; all original item labels, Master Jewelry Labels (if configured), and/or Large Ticket Labels (if configured) will be printed instead.
- Jewelry Only - Vault labels will print only for jewelry items that are part of loans or buy tickets. original item labels and/or Large Ticket Labels (if configured) will print for general merchandise items, and normal-sized price tags (butterfly labels) will print for jewelry inventory items.
- All - Vault labels will print for all item types on loan or buy. Normal-sized price tags will print for inventory items.
If the Print Master Jewelry Label checkbox is enabled and Vault Labels are configured to print for jewelry items, the item numbering for jewelry ticket items will follow the same numbering system used for Master Jewelry Labels. All of the jewelry items will be grouped together under the "-00" ticket item number, and the associated barcode on the Vault Label will match this numbering. Below the barcode, the same description will print as the one shown on the Master Jewelry Label. The description can occupy up to two lines, and a sum of the total jewelry weight will also appear beneath the description. Next to the total jewelry weight, the location will appear, followed either by the number of items represented by the item number (for Master Jewelry Label jewelry items) and the total number of items on the ticket.

For General Merchandise items, vault labels will print the full item number, including the "-XX", where 'XX' is replaced by the ordered number of the item on the loan/buy ticket. The associated barcode will appear beneath the item number, and below that, up to two lines will be occupied by the item's description. The next line will show the location of the item (if set during printing) and the ordered item number on the loan/buy/consignment hold ticket and the total number of items on the ticket.
The loan/buy amount and customer's name appear beneath the location, and the very bottom line will display "Buy" if the ticket is a buy ticket, "Pawn" if the ticket is a new pawn, or the old ticket number if the loan was renewed to a new ticket number. On the opposite side of the bottom line will be the Date.
Finally, written in rotated text on the right side of the Vault Label, the store's 3-letter print code will be printed along the side of the barcode and item description lines.
